Average monthly wind speed in Barranquilla

On this page you will find more information about the mean monthly wind speed over the year in Barranquilla (Atlántico), Colombia.

Data from: Barranquila, Colombia (9 KM, 5 Miles).

Annually, wind speeds in Barranquilla vary between 2 m/s (4 knots) at their lowest and 6 m/s (12 knots) at their peak.

An average wind speed of 2 m/s (4 knots) in June, September and October means a light breeze in Barranquilla. This implies that on certain days, the air will be nearly still. There could also be higher gusts on other days. However on an average day, when it is 2 m/s (4 knots), you would feel a gentle caress of wind on your face and see leaves rustling. It's about 7.2 km/h or 4.5 mph on average. he wind conditions are generally mild enough to enjoy being outside throughout the month

In contrast, wind speeds average 6 m/s (12 knots) during January, February and March; these months are known as the windiest. Most days are quite windy, with small branches moving and occasional difficulty walking against the wind. Loose objects may be blown away. The measurement represents 21.6 km/h or 13.4 mph. There may still be stronger gusts or calmer moments, but strong winds are typical.
